In den WarenkorbNo Binding. Zustand: Good. Two very rare documents, (2), (2)pp, each printed on official British Government Crown and Stationery Office (SO) watermarked foolscap. Good with single horizontal fold, creased and tanned with some spotting and a couple of short closed tears. Undated c1941-42. No author or publisher is indicated, but…they appear to have been issued as part of the British Commonwealth Air Training Plan, also known as the Empire Air Training Scheme, or "The Plan". This remains the largest scheme of its kind, covering almost half the pilots, navigators, bomb aimers, air gunners, wireless operators and flight engineers in the RAF, Royal Navy Fleet Air Arm, RAAF, RCAF, and RNZAF. Parallel to this, the South African Air Force ran a programme for its own aircrew and other Allied air forces. This pair of cross-referring notes informs pilots about dust and sandstorms encountered along the route to India via the Western (Libyan) Desert, Arabia and the Gulf. NOTE 2 explains the conditions necessary for these to occur in the Western Desert, with Mediterranean cold fronts being the "the most frequent cause", and various types of depressions including over Palestine and Syria. NOTE 3 adds observations on sandstorms in Winter, Spring and Summer driven by the switch between the NE and SW Monsoon over the Arabian Sea and India, the Shamal over western Persia, the Sirocco over Palestine, Syria and western Iraq, etc. Sandstorms can extend further east along the route to Persia and Baluchistan, while dust haze extends SE over the Gulf to Bahrain and possibly beyond. [ William Lawrence Balls, botanist. ] Ten Typed Letters Signed (all 'W Lawrence Balls') to G. K. Menzies, Secretary, Royal Society of Arts
William Lawrence Balls (1882-1960), FRS, botanist who specialised in cotton technology [ the Fine Cotton Spinners' and Doublers' Association, Limited, Manchester; Royal Society of Arts, London ]

In den WarenkorbThe ten letters total 4pp., landscape 8vo, and 6pp., 4to. The collection in good condition, lightly aged and worn. With stamps and annotations of the Royal Society of Arts. The correspondence relates to a lecture given by him by invitation, and its subsequent publication in the Society's journal. He originally suggests that it b…e titled 'The Application of Science to economic purposes, with illustrations from the Cotton Trade', thinking that it would 'attract people outside cotton circles', but is persuaded to alter this to 'Examples of Applied Science in the Cotton Industry'. Before giving the lecture he writes (15 January 1918): 'I never write up a paper before giving it, except under compulsion, and then it is different! Do you keep a stenographer?'.

In den WarenkorbSee the entries for Dicksee and Lady Orchardson's husband Sir William Quiller Orchardson (1832-1910), RA, in the Oxford DNB. Lady Orchardson (1853-1917) was the daughter of the London publisher Charles Moxon. The Orchardsons married in 1873. Among their four children was the painter Charles Moxon Quiller Orchardson (1873-1917),…who studied in the Royal Academy Schools and was killed in action during World War One. 3pp, 12mo. Bifolium. In good condition, lightly aged. Folded once for postage. Signed 'Frank Dicksee'. Begins: 'Dear Lady Orchardson - / I am so very sorry that I missed seeing you when you called on Sunday. I should have written sooner - but thought I would wait until after the Committee meeting [for the Royal Academy summer exhibtion] this afternoon'. He felt that committee would 'all desire to see the bust by Onslow Ford included in the Exhibition - & that I need hardly say is the case'. Nearly all the pictures have been 'sent in', and they will have 'a very fine show but we shall miss some we should dearly like to have'. The ODNB also has an entry for the sculptor Edward Onslow Ford (1852-1901), who participated in several Royal Academy summer exhibitions.

Addressed to Sir William Symonds (1782-1856), Surveyor of the Navy, naval architect and rear admiral. He troubled Symonds the previous summer with 'a book upon naval signals'. 'The appearance of another work upon the same subject has induced me to write the accompanying little tract, which perhaps you may find time to glance over. I am only anxious for a fair trial of my system.' PAMPHLET: octavo, thirty pages. Several illustrations of flags. Disbound. Aged and creased. Cropped ownership inscription of 'W. Symonds R.N.' at head of title. The pamphlet performs 'the disagreeable, and perhaps somewhat invidious task, of pointing out the more prominent defects in Captain Rohdes' system', and contrasts it with 'his own plan', ending with four pages of 'NUMERAL SIGNALS. [.] The Numbers to be shewn over A WHEFT.'.
